What is Listing Contract

The Limited Full Service Listing Contract is a real estate document used by sellers in Oregon to grant a broker the exclusive right to sell their property.

What is the Limited Full Service Listing Contract?

The Limited Full Service Listing Contract is a crucial legal document in Oregon real estate, granting exclusive selling rights to a broker. This agreement outlines the specific roles and responsibilities of both the seller and the broker, making it a vital component for anyone looking to navigate the complexities of property sales in Oregon.
This contract facilitates a seller's ability to access professional assistance while retaining control over their property sale. Understanding its significance can lead to a more effective and streamlined selling process.

Purpose and Benefits of the Limited Full Service Listing Contract

This contract offers several key advantages to both sellers and brokers. Primarily, it provides sellers with the exclusive right to sell their property, ensuring that only their chosen broker represents them in the market.
Moreover, brokers provide professional marketing and negotiation support, enhancing the visibility and appeal of the property. The contract tends to be more cost-effective than traditional full-service listings, allowing sellers to save on fees while receiving expert support.

Key Features of the Limited Full Service Listing Contract

The Limited Full Service Listing Contract encompasses several primary attributes. Key responsibilities are clearly defined for both sellers and brokers, ensuring that each party understands their obligations throughout the selling process.
  • Fillable fields include essential details like listing prices, service fees, and specific property information.
  • The document adheres to Oregon property disclosure laws, reinforcing legal compliance.
These features not only facilitate a smoother transaction but also safeguard the interests of both parties involved.
